Social Media’s Influence on Breaking News Trends

In fact, social media sites are the main means through which the news is distributed at present. A singular entry in such a network can be instrumental in the diffusion of facts throughout the world even before old means can present their report in detail. It has become therefore, easier and faster for journalists to get an insight into what is going on by looking at the most widely used hashtags, content uploaded by users, and live streaming. In the same way, readers depend more and more on these sites to watch viral videos, which are the fastest way to understand crowded movements, nature’s fury, political events of great importance, etc. 

In general, people get the idea of what has happened by catching the portion of a news event that is shown in a video. After that, they wait for the official communication to be given out afterwards. On the other hand, there are drawbacks associated with the speed of news delivery. Inaccurate pieces of news may be easily duplicated and spread widely just as well as truthful ones. 

Media has to carefully decide when to give out the information in order to be first and, at the same time, correct. On the other side of the coin, viewers are advised to check sources before they put their trust in what they have witnessed. The implementation of fact-checking and production of news in a disciplined way have always been very important, but at present, their significance is utmost.

The Responsibility of Readers in the Digital Age 

As much as news entities are restructuring themselves, the readers are not devoid of duties either. Since sharing content has been made very easy, practically, everyone can put themselves in the position of the disseminator of the news. Acting as a consumer of the news means that one must understand the context, verify the source, and be careful not to be fooled by sensationalism. This way of news consumption is one of the ways to ensure that the news ecosystem is the community of information that is in good health. 

Instructional programs and media literacy have also been recognized as very important and are geared towards equipping the public with the skills needed to differentiate between trustworthy reporting and deceitful ones. When consumers opt for quality rather than getting shocked, they contribute to the support of moral journalism and a viable public debate.
